AI Algorithms in Diagnosis
AI algorithms have evolved to offer unprecedented capabilities in diagnosing diseases. The sophistication of these algorithms allows them to discern minute details in imaging studies that might escape human observation. For instance, AI systems can recognize patterns in X-rays and MRI scans, leading to earlier and more accurate diagnoses. They not only assist in identifying conditions but also in determining the best immediate course of action, thereby dramatically enhancing the quality of care.

Smart Inventory Management
Another significant application of IoT in hospitals is smart inventory management, which automates the tracking of medical supplies and equipment. By employing connected devices, hospitals can accurately monitor inventory levels in real-time, reducing waste and ensuring that essential supplies are always available. This technology minimizes human error and enhances efficiency, allowing healthcare professionals to focus more on patient care rather than administrative tasks. Drawbacks of Tech Innovations in Healthcare
- High initial costs for implementation and training.
- Cybersecurity risks associated with sensitive patient data.
- Potential for over-reliance on technology, diminishing human interaction.
- Resistance to change among healthcare staff.
- Integration challenges with existing systems and technologies.
- Data privacy concerns from patients regarding how information is used.
Despite the challenges, the potential for significant advancements remains. Healthcare providers must address these shortcomings to maximize the positive impact of tech innovations. By implementing robust training programs and prioritizing cybersecurity measures, organizations can foster an environment conducive to technological growth. Additionally, effective change management strategies can help mitigate resistance among healthcare staff, ensuring a smoother transition into a tech-forward environment.
